Output 80f5870ef8d4e97ed0b335b85e6dd5549e70fc00c022c6e75eef26b59b719f4d:2

value
19817000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8b34b64803e6992e6efef6187375f91646fee6 OP_EQUAL
address
32vdUEViRvkgwX14gK3Gh1EPRU2arCu749
transaction
80f5870ef8d4e97ed0b335b85e6dd5549e70fc00c022c6e75eef26b59b719f4d
spent
true